Kenya Climate Smart Agriculture Strategy 2017 – 2026. Its Mission is to facilitate agriculture that sustainably increases productivity, enhances resilience and minimizes greenhouse gas emissions. The overall objective of this strategy is to build resilience and minimize emissions from agricultural farming systems for enhanced food and nutritional security and improved livelihoods. The Specific Objectives are: 1) To enhance adaptive capacity and resilience of farmers, pastoralists and fisher-folk to the adverse impacts of climate change. 2) To develop mechanisms that minimize greenhouse gas emissions from agricultural production systems. 3) To improve coordination and collaboration among institutions and stakeholders in climate smart agriculture. 4) To address cross-cutting issues that adversely impact or enhance CSA.
